Eligibility Criteria for Ph.D. in Agriculture at Nirwan University

  • Master?s degree (M.Sc., M.Agr., M.Tech., or equivalent) with a minimum of 55% aggregate marks (or 5.0 CGPA on a 10?point scale).
  • Valid GATE/ICAR or university?conducted entrance test score (if applicable).
  • Research proposal aligned with the university?s focal areas in agriculture.
  • English language proficiency (IELTS/TOEFL) for international candidates.

Entrance Exam for Ph.D. in Agriculture at Nirwan University

The entrance examination evaluates both theoretical knowledge and research aptitude. It consists of:

  • Written Test (120 minutes): 100 multiple?choice questions covering advanced agronomy, plant genetics, soil science, and research methodology.
  • Interview (30 minutes): Presentation of the research proposal and discussion of prior academic work.

Candidates can also gain admission through a direct interview route if they possess a strong publication record in indexed journals.

Fee Structure for Ph.D. in Agriculture at Nirwan University

Fee Component Amount (INR) Notes
Application & Registration Fee 5,000 One?time, non?refundable
Annual Tuition & Lab Charges 85,000 Payable at the start of each academic year
Research Material & Field Work Allowance 30,000 Includes travel and consumables for experiments
Library & Digital Resources 10,000 Access to premium databases and journals
Miscellaneous (Student Services, Insurance) 5,000 Annual estimate
Total Approximate Cost (3?Year Program) 300,000  

Admission Process for Ph.D. in Agriculture at Nirwan University

  1. Online application submission through the university portal.
  2. Upload scanned copies of academic transcripts, research proposal, and identification documents.
  3. Pay the non?refundable application fee.
  4. Appear for the written entrance test (or submit GATE/ICAR scores).
  5. Shortlisted candidates are called for a personal interview.
  6. Final selection based on academic merit, research proposal strength, and interview performance.
  7. Admission letter issued; candidates must confirm acceptance within 15 days.

Ph.D. Subjects and Specializations in Agriculture at Nirwan University

Students can choose from a wide range of specializations, including:

  • Crop Physiology and Genetics
  • Soil Health and Nutrient Management
  • Plant Pathology and Integrated Pest Management
  • Horticultural Sciences and Post?Harvest Technology
  • Agricultural Engineering and Precision Farming
  • Agri?Business Management and Policy Studies
  • Climate?Smart Agriculture and Sustainable Farming Systems

Research Areas in Agriculture at Nirwan University

The university?s research ecosystem encourages interdisciplinary projects such as:

  • Genomic editing for drought?tolerant varieties.
  • Bio?fertilizer development using microbial consortia.
  • Remote sensing and GIS applications in precision agriculture.
  • Carbon sequestration techniques in cropping systems.
  • Value?addition and supply?chain optimization for horticultural produce.
  • Policy analysis on agrarian reforms and farmer welfare.

Nirwan University Ph.D. Syllabus for Agriculture

The syllabus is structured into three phases:

  1. Coursework (Year 1): Advanced modules on research methodology, statistical analysis, and core subject electives.
  2. Comprehensive Exam (End of Year 1): Written and oral assessment to evaluate depth of knowledge.
  3. Thesis Research (Years 2?3): Original research, periodic progress seminars, and a final defense.

Scholarship for Ph.D. in Agriculture at Nirwan University

The university offers merit?based scholarships covering up to 50% of tuition fees, along with research stipends for qualifying candidates. Additional financial support is available through:

  • ICAR research fellowships.
  • Government-sponsored scholarships for women and under?represented groups.
  • Industry?funded project grants aligned with faculty research themes.

FAQs Regarding Ph.D. in Agriculture at Nirwan University

What is the minimum duration of the Ph.D. program?
The program is typically completed in 3 years, subject to satisfactory progress and thesis submission.
Can I pursue the Ph.D. part?time while working?
Yes, Nirwan University offers a flexible part?time track with extended timelines and evening seminars.
Is there a provision for publishing my research before graduation?
Absolutely. The university provides Research Publication Support to help students publish in high?impact journals.
Do I need to have prior teaching experience?
No, teaching experience is not mandatory, but the program includes pedagogical workshops for those interested in academic careers.
How are dissertations evaluated?
The thesis undergoes internal evaluation by a panel of experts, followed by an external examiner appointed by the university?s doctoral board.
Are there opportunities for international collaborations?
Yes, the university has MoUs with several global institutions, facilitating joint research projects and exchange programs.
